A flow net is a graphical solution to the Laplace equation for twodimensional flow for
flow through a homogenous, isotropic kh kv medium. Applications of Flow nets include
estimate:
of SEEPAGE under impermeable and through permeable dam structure.
leakage SEEPAGE into empty tunnels and out of water filled tunnels
leakage SEEPAGE from water reservoir.
The flow nets can also be used to calculate the pore pressure on the dam construction. The pore
pressure and total potential are related according to:
where
H total potential
z the distance to the point of interest below referencedatum level
pore water pressure at the point of interest
density of water
acceleration due to gravity
If you know the total potential at a point of interest you can also compute the pore pressure
at the same point.
